RTD WANTS TO HEAR FROM YOU
  

Hello RTD Stakeholders,

 


 

The Regional Transportation District wants to hear from YOU! As the RTD Board of Directors contemplates whether to pursue a sales tax increase vote in 2011 to complete the FasTracks program, we want to provide the Board with as much information as possible to assist them in this very important decision. One of the most important pieces of information we are seeking is how the general public feels about this matter being put into their hands this year or perhaps sometime in the future.

For the next three weeks, we are putting out a "Call to the People" asking the public to tell us what they think.

 

We encourage you to be a part of this process. Please view a brief personal video message from me about FasTracks, why we are looking for additional revenues to complete the program and when RTD should bring a tax vote to the public to decide. The video is posted to the RTD website. Then please weigh in on this important regional matter by telling us your preference on a potential sales tax vote by selecting one of the below options:  

  • In 2011, to complete FasTracks in the next 8 years by 2019.
  • In the future, which will increase the cost and schedule for completing FasTracks.
  • With no additional sales taxes, which would complete FasTracks in the next 31 years by 2042.
